Trail Overview

Widow Maker Road is a point-to-point 4/10 trail running through BLM and Utah Trust lands in the Honda Hills area north of Vernal, Utah. Mostly desert terrain, it stretches across flat open land and tackles climbs and descents over multiple ridgelines. The southwestern part is generally open desert two-track, while the northeastern third offers the toughest challenges with climbs and descents coupled with off-camber tight switchbacks and rutted shelf roads. It’s open to all vehicles, but the bigger the vehicle, the tougher the ride—full-sized rigs face obstacles that smaller ones like an SxS can handle more easily. Overall, it’s a mix of great views and fun technical sections.

Difficulty

The northeastern third offers the toughest challenges with climbs and descents coupled with off-camber tight switchbacks and rutted shelf roads. Rating could be higher if the surface has seen recent precipitation.
